The Protein Electrophoresis Test measures and separates proteins in the blood based on their electrical properties, providing a detailed assessment of major protein fractions, including albumin and globulins. Abnormal protein patterns may be associated with inflammatory conditions, liver or kidney disease, immune disorders, nutritional deficiencies, or plasma cell disorders such as multiple myeloma. This test is commonly used to investigate unexplained fatigue, anemia, recurrent infections, elevated total protein levels, or other abnormal laboratory findings, and helps support the diagnosis and monitoring of a wide range of systemic conditions.
